In today's industrial landscape, safety and efficiency are paramount, especially in environments where hazardous materials are handled. One critical component that helps ensure both safety and operational integrity is the anti-explosion packing gland. This device plays a vital role in preventing the escape of gases and liquids that could potentially lead to explosive situations. Understanding the functionality and importance of the anti-explosion packing gland is essential for professionals in various fields, including engineering, manufacturing, and maintenance.The anti-explosion packing gland is designed to create a tight seal around rotating shafts, which are often found in pumps and compressors. These glands are made from durable materials that can withstand extreme pressure and temperature fluctuations. The primary purpose of this component is to prevent leaks of flammable or toxic substances that could ignite and cause an explosion. By maintaining a secure seal, the anti-explosion packing gland not only protects workers but also safeguards the surrounding environment.Moreover, the design of the anti-explosion packing gland incorporates features that enhance its performance. For instance, many modern packing glands include advanced sealing technologies that improve their ability to resist wear and tear over time. This is particularly important in industries such as oil and gas, where equipment is subjected to harsh conditions. Regular maintenance and inspection of these packing glands are crucial to ensure they function correctly and provide the necessary protection against explosions.The installation of a reliable anti-explosion packing gland can significantly reduce the risk of accidents in high-risk environments. It acts as a barrier, containing any potential leaks that could escalate into dangerous situations. In addition to its protective capabilities, the anti-explosion packing gland also contributes to the overall efficiency of machinery. By preventing leaks, it helps maintain optimal operating conditions, which can lead to lower energy consumption and reduced operational costs.Furthermore, regulatory standards often mandate the use of anti-explosion packing glands in certain industries, reflecting their importance in maintaining safety protocols. Compliance with these regulations not only protects workers but also enhances a company's reputation by demonstrating a commitment to safety and environmental responsibility. Organizations that prioritize the implementation of safety measures, such as the use of anti-explosion packing glands, are more likely to achieve long-term success in their operations.In conclusion, the anti-explosion packing gland is a crucial component in ensuring safety and efficiency in industrial applications. Its ability to prevent leaks and contain hazardous materials makes it an indispensable part of machinery used in high-risk environments. As industries continue to evolve and face new challenges, the importance of reliable safety devices like the anti-explosion packing gland will only grow. Investing in quality components and adhering to safety regulations will ultimately lead to a safer workplace and a more sustainable future for all involved.
